This position is open until filled with an initial application review to take place on March 16, 2026 The starting salary range for this position is $5910.00 - $6460.00 per month depending upon qualifications and is non-negotiable FUNCTION OF THE UNIT Academy for Professional Excellence , a project of San Diego State University School of Social Work , was established in 1996 with the goal of revolutionizing the way people work to ensure the world is a healthier place. Our services integrate culturally responsive and recovery-oriented practices into our daily work to promote healing and healthy relationships. Providing approximately 50,000 learning experiences to health and human service and justice system professionals annually, the Academy provides a variety of workforce development solutions in Southern California and beyond. With seven programs, three divisions and over 100 staff, the Academy’s mission is to provide exceptional learning and development experiences for the transformation of individuals, organizations, and communities. As a member of the Academy team you will be engaging in communal development of heart, mind, and practice. You are expected to foster culturally responsive practice behaviors to promote well-being and a culture that focuses on healing, healthy relationships and changed behaviors. The Learning Experience Designer position is housed in the Strategy, Development, & Organizational Advancement Division (30 employees) within the Learning and Brand Development Unit (15 employees) which is responsible for strategic development of learning, products, and practices that strengthen our organizational culture, brand identity, and ability to fulfill our promise. Specifically, the position will be part of the Learning Experience Design Team (7 employees). The overall Division nurtures organizational health and facilitates innovation by building responsive and proactive evaluation, strategy, and system solutions grounded in data, best practice, and collaborative partnerships.

Responsibilities

  • Digital Learning Product Design and Content Development Design, write, revise eLearnings, microlearnings, and other asynchronous learning products that apply adult learning theory and universal design principles to ensure complex concepts are clearly communicated in content developed by subject matter experts (SMEs) and curriculum developers.
  • Build self-paced learning products using advanced authoring tools (e.g. Storyline and Rise) that support both highly customized interactions and rapid, mobile-responsive course development.
  • Interpret and refine behaviorally specific learning objectives for eLearning modules.
  • Assess content developed by SMEs and curriculum developers and drive enhancements by researching, designing, and implementing culturally responsive skill and knowledge-based exercises and case scenarios that promote transfer of learning.
  • Create comprehensive eLearning storyboards, including scripts, onscreen content, learner interactions, animations, knowledge checks, and accessible elements.
  • Develop storyboards in partnership with User Experience (UX) Designers for eLearning and microlearning modules to guide visual communication and design that increase learner-centered insights.
  • Produce high-quality supplemental resources in multiple formats to support diverse learner needs and enhance course engagement.
  • Produce, record, edit, and caption voiceover narration for eLearning and microlearning courses; conduct video editing for webinar-style learning modules.
  • Review video and audio files to ensure correct settings (format, size, and quality) to optimize for delivery.
  • Manage the publishing and uploading of eLearning and Microlearning SCORM files to the Academy’s Learning Management System (LMS).
  • Conduct quality assurance and accessibility testing at all stages of course development including NonVisual Desktop Access (NVDA) screen-reader and keyboard-only navigation.
  • Engage in two-phased Internal Review/Quality Control (IR/QC) process for all courses designed by the LXD team.
  • Integrate feedback from IR/QC processes and prepare the alpha versions of fully programmed courses for partner review and release; may require audio pickups.
  • Manage all phases of eLearning project deliverables, including timeline management, coordination of storyboard review cycles, compilation and integration of internal and external partner feedback, assigning of project responsibilities, and ensuring timely, successful project completion.
  • Engage partners and UX Designers throughout the project lifecycle to clarify learning objectives, product goals, and timelines; adjust timelines as needed.
  • Consult and present strategic concepts and creative recommendations to partners.
  • Research new learning development tools, updated software features, and trending technologies that improve design processes and drive innovation.
  • Improve, experiment, problem-solve, and test new educational technology tools to engage intended Academy audiences.
  • Create detailed documentation that addresses technical challenges and supports effective knowledge sharing across the team.
  • Present and demonstrate research findings, solutions, and prototypes to teammates and in consultation with program leads and potential business partners.
